Output 341712322eafbe5af86e059d0086ae28b7e8586a9c04e70816aae84759ae97f0:0

value
2978
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 886b1ba3b4663dca55ca4f37b6d9477121f18ab9a524fb93c6e9ad9eb924e4d9
address
bc1p3p43hga5vc7u54w2fummdk28wyslrz4e55j0hy7xaxkeawfyunvs0z0wzy
transaction
341712322eafbe5af86e059d0086ae28b7e8586a9c04e70816aae84759ae97f0